Thomas Allen Jr. (American 1849-1924) “Dish of Lemons”, pastel on paper, initialed lower right TA. Born in St. Louis, MO, Thomas Allen Jr. was a painter known for his landscape and animal subjects. He settled in Boston where he chaired the faculty of the Boston Museum School of Drawing and Painting and was president of the Boston Museum of Fine Arts. He exhibited at the Paris Salon, National Academy of Design, Boston Art Club, and Art Institute of Chicago.
